Claims an undivided Moiety of a certain part of the Township of Claverick. See the Title of John Shepard for the title into Elihu Chancey Goodrich and his Deed for the one moiety in the late Commissioners' book of titles in Claverick. See the copy of the Order of the Orphans' Court filed, Granting liberty to David Waterman, Administrator of Elihu Chancy Goodrich, dec"., to Sell all the right to Lands that the said Goodrich had in Claverick. Deed 10 March, 1807. Con: 450 DIs. David Waterman, Administrator of Elihu Chancy Goodrich to claimant for all the equal Moiety with John Shepard that he holds by virtue of a purchase froin Elihu Chancy Goodrich in the Township of Claverick, containing in the whole about 16,000 acres, be the same more or less.
